Breaking Down the Features: Why It’s More Than Just a Calendar

Okay, so it’s a digital calendar. Big deal, right? Wrong. The FRAMEO Smart Calendar is packed with features that make it specifically useful for homeschool families. Let’s break down the ones that matter most:

Feature What It Does Why Homeschool Families Love It
WiFi Digital Syncing Connects to your home WiFi to update schedules in real time across devices Mom can add a field trip from her phone while at the grocery store; dad can approve a co-op class change from work—no more “I told you about that!” arguments
Touchscreen Interface Tap, drag, and drop events with your finger—no stylus needed Kids as young as 5 can check their own schedules; no fumbling with tiny app buttons or tiny pen scribbles
Family Planner Mode Color-code events by person (e.g., blue for math, pink for art, green for family outings) At a glance, see who has what—no more “Is that your dentist appt or mine?” confusion
Voice-Activated Reminders Set alerts for events, and the calendar will chime or even announce (e.g., “Science experiment time in 10 minutes!”) Perfect for kids who zone out—no more “Did you forget we were supposed to start history?”
Wall-Mountable Design Hang it on the wall like a traditional calendar, or set it on a desk Keeps it front and center—no more hiding in a drawer or app folder

1. WiFi Digital Calendar: No More “Did You See the Note?”

Remember when you’d write a reminder on the fridge and your spouse would swear they “never saw it”? With the FRAMEO Smart Calendar’s WiFi sync, that’s history. It connects to your home network, so any update you make on your phone (via the Akimart app) shows up on the calendar instantly. Forgot to add the spelling bee? Tap it into your phone while waiting in the carpool line, and it’s there when you walk in the door. Partner needs to move piano lessons to Thursday? They can do it from their laptop at work, and you’ll see the change the second you glance at the calendar.

And it’s not just about adding events. You can set recurring events—like weekly co-op classes or daily math practice—so you don’t have to retype them every time. Missed an event? No problem—you can go back and view past weeks to see what you did (great for those end-of-semester portfolio reviews when you need to list all the field trips you took).
